The only differences arethatcase names are notitalicised,pinpointing is not used andthere is no full stop at the end of the reference. These should be ordered in alphabetical order by the first significant word of the title. Footnotes should be closed with a full stop, Titles of books and case names are to be italicised, Semi-colons may be used to separate a reference to two different sources in a footnote, Quotations longer than three lines should be presented within an indented paragraph with no quotation marks. Reference list entries for treaties or international conventions should include the name of the treaty, convention etc., the signing or approval date, and the URL (if available). Case name should always be in italics both in-text and in the footnotes, but not in the bibliography, If you have actually said the full name of the case in the text, only the subsequent information is required in the footnote. When citing judgments from the ECtHR useeitherthe official reports called theReports of Judgments and Decisions(cited as ECHR)ortheEuropean Human Rights Reports(EHRR)but be consistent.
